I have installed firmware version 9.2 on my 888 with SL-2.  There are 8 selectable slot inputs seen by the 888.  However only the first two channels of each slot are passing audio when I run tone from all four channels of the DSR4. Additionaly, it does not automatically switch the DSR4 outputs from analog to AES.  I’ve submitted the bug to Sound Devices.  Anyone else experiencing this?  

Update on the SD v9.2 firmware issue I mentioned above.  
Apparently the SL-2 cannot use a digital receiver in one slot and an analog receiver in the second.  When I use just the DSR4 by itself all 4 channels output as AES3.  When an SRC is in the remaining slot the SL-2 forces the DSR4 back to analog outputs and you only get 2.  Was in communication with SD support on this today.  The firmware update was only intended for 2 DSR4s.

Ooof…hate to be THAT guy…but this issue or function was already discussed earlier in this thread. Way before these units were even shipped.
 

The SL2 settings are global, all AES or all ANALOG.   
 

 Whenever powering up the 8 series (w/ SL2) if the SRC is off and DSR4 is on it WILL default to AES. But if SRC is on (w/ DSR4 in SL2) it will default to ANALOG.

If you really want a DSR4 + an older analog SR, you could use a PSC Four Pack + Sound Devices 8 Series AES "barnacle".  You'll lose 8 series integration but you'll save $600+, gain a power distro (built into the four pack), and save yourself another $4500+ from buying a 2nd DSR4 if you don't really need it.  It's a bit work 'roundish but it is an option.

This just in from Gotham Sound:

 

“Lectrosonics let us know that the release of the 2 channel DSR has been delayed for upgrades to the RF performance as well as to more closely match the front panel of the recently released DSR4.  These improvements will most likely cause a 2 or 3 month delay.”

Aaton Hydra supported with the latest firmware.

FW 3.530.C12   - November 02, 2023

Cantar X3 3.530.C12 (02-11-2023)

New features:

- Hydra compatibility with the new Lectro DSR4 HF receiver (Four Channel Digital Slot Receiver).
After seated the DSR4 in his slot, a reset of the Tx location is needed once.
